When can I apply to MIT 2022?

MIT has its own online application, which is available online from mid-August through January 1. The application fee is $75. If paying the fee presents a hardship for applicants, fee waivers are available upon request. The application deadline for Early Action is November 1, and January 1 for Regular Action.

Does MIT require SAT 2022?

Students applying to the Massachusetts Institute of Technology in 2022 will have to submit SAT or ACT exam scores, the university announced on Monday, nearly two years after suspending the requirement because the pandemic had disrupted testing for many applicants.

Does MIT require 2022 GRE?

For the 2022 and 2023 graduate admission process, given the potential difficulty in access to testing due to the Covid-19 outbreak, the department of Mechanical Engineering will not require GRE tests for applications for graduate admission for 2022 and 2023.

Will MIT require SAT for 2023?

We have updated our testing requirement for the 2022–23 application cycle. ⁠01. The requirements below are updated and accurate for all applicants seeking admission to enter MIT in 2023 and beyond. We require the SAT or the ACT for both prospective first year and transfer students.

Do all MIT applicants get interviews?

Interviews are not a required part of the MIT application. While we try to offer as many interviews as we can, we have limited availability and may not able to offer interviews to all applicants. If your interview is waived, it will not put you at a disadvantage in the admissions process.

What does by November 1st mean?

A November 1 deadline means that you can submit your application through 11:59 PM Eastern Time on November 1. So for those of you who thought you’d have to miss out on Halloween fun tonight, no worries: you can have your candy and ED too.

Is 1550 enough for MIT?

Since the MIT Class of 2024 had a 50% percentile range of 1520-1580, you want to aim for meeting the 1520 threshold at a minimum and aim for the middle 1550 a goal. If you are at 1550 or above, there is no point in trying to improve upon that score.

Can I get into MIT with a 2.0 GPA?

MIT doesn’t specify a minimum GPA requirement and doesn’t release the average GPA of admitted applicants. (The school does provide other admissions statistics like average test scores.) That being said, due to the caliber of students accepted at MIT, we can assume that the average GPA is quite high.

What is the lowest GPA accepted by MIT?

There’s no minimum required GPA, however, competitive applicants typically have a 3.5 GPA or above, and mostly As in math and science courses. Ideal preparation includes—at the very least—one year each of college-level calculus and calculus-based physics.
